4. CAS客戶端與SpringSecurity集成 4.1 Spring Security測試工程搭建 (1)建立Maven項目casclient_demo3 ,引入spring依賴和spring secrity 相關依賴 ,tomcat端口設置為9003 (2)建立web.xml ,添加 ...
keycloak作為cas客戶端背景 .keycloak本身不支持Cas協議,考慮到市場上使用Cas Server做認證的企業較多,將keycloak與Cas server進行集成,相當於keycloak作為cas的客戶端。 .采用三方支持的方式,讓keycloak支持cas客戶端 .keycloak集成cas客戶端后,cas server回調keycloak .keycloak初始化sessio ...
2018-06-11 15:34 0 1263 推薦指數:
4. CAS客戶端與SpringSecurity集成 4.1 Spring Security測試工程搭建 (1)建立Maven項目casclient_demo3 ,引入spring依賴和spring secrity 相關依賴 ,tomcat端口設置為9003 (2)建立web.xml ,添加 ...
一、CAS Client 與受保護的客戶端應用部署在一起,以 Filter 方式保護受保護的資源。對於訪問受保護資源的每個 Web 請求,CAS Client 會分析該請求的 Http 請求中是否包含 Service Ticket,如果沒有,則說明當前用戶尚未登錄,於是將請求重定向到指定 ...
pom中添加maven依賴 application.yml中添加cas配置信息 ...
使用場景: 移動端通過業務系統鑒權 移動端免登錄(登錄一次以后) 解決方案: JWT(token認證方案) OAuth(第三方認證) 疑問 當然我們這章是講JWT,那么會有以下的疑問: 若服務端已經接入了SSO,那么在移動端用戶登錄信息提交給SSO ...
cas單點登錄旨在解決傳統登錄模式session在分布式項目中共享登錄信息的問題。 本文cas服務器使用 4.0版本,僅供學習參考。把 cas.war 直接部署在tomcat即可,這里有個固定的用戶名和密碼 casuser /Mellon 修改密碼在 cas/WEB-INF ...
服務部署: 環境准備: JDK: 1.8 cas-overlay-template :5.3.x https://github.com/apereo/cas-overlay-template maven:3.6.3 導入IDEA,此時會去下載一個依賴 ...
0.說明 本系列文章只根據自己的需要做部分定制,完整的教程見:https://blog.csdn.net/qq_34021712/category_9278675.html 有興趣的可以一起研究。 1.服務端 1.1.Service配置 客戶端接入 CAS 首先需要在服務端進行注冊 ...
有好幾個系統需要接入CAS,所以登錄模塊統統需要重構 版本 CAS服務端是Java的 Cas-server-4.0 CAS的php客戶端 是 phpCAS-1.2.0 論壇版本是 Discuz!X3.3 Discuz! 登錄流程 因為discuz原來的流程是驗證 ...